Transaction 75ddfa259140e49cfe7e3e2798950b253e738bcc54df4a5bbf4929bdc338850c

1 Input
2 Outputs
  • 75ddfa259140e49cfe7e3e2798950b253e738bcc54df4a5bbf4929bdc338850c:0
  • value  673449
    address  3Nf2b7jAKnuLsV5nCaA2FQbRF2WKA62B65
  • 75ddfa259140e49cfe7e3e2798950b253e738bcc54df4a5bbf4929bdc338850c:1
  • value  1480946
    address  12B2vcAiTknSszBvkHtKy2t5BFGqGM16LA